A 22-year-old woman was hospitalized last night with a head injury after falling six floors in an apartment building elevator, NY1 reports. After visiting her neighbor on the sixth floor of 90 Pinehurst Street in Washington Heights, Jessica Carter entered an elevator which malfunctioned and crashed to the basement. No details yet on the extent of her injuries, but she was admitted to St. Luke's Hospital around midnight with head injuries. And residents in the building are outraged because a few months ago the elevator fell from the first floor to the basement, hospitalizing one resident. The building's superintendent denies any prior problems with the elevator, but the Department of Buildings is investigating. And we'll be taking the stairs today.

Four more people can be added to the total number of New Yorkers who have been run down by drivers finding it difficult to stay on the road this weekend. In the fourth incident in two days, two toddlers were badly injured when a 16-year-old driver swerved onto the sidewalk in Flatbush, Brooklyn and injured two children and two young women. Both of the toddlers needed to be hospitalized--one in critical condition and the other in stable condition.
